Price Range & Condition
In very good condition, we estimate 43, Rupert Street, Manchester would be worth £121,738, with a potential rental value of £736 per month.
If substantial cosmetic improvements are needed, the estimated sale value falls to £107,825, with a rental value of £652 per month.
The extent to which decoration affects a property's value depends on its type, size and location.
Energy Efficiency
43, Rupert Street, Manchester has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of C.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 27 Nov 2024.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using Boiler and radiators, mains gas.
Sold Prices
43, Rupert Street, Manchester last changed hands on 10th January 2020, selling for £87,500. The transaction was logged as a leasehold house by HM Land Registry.
In total it has sold 3 times since 1995.
The market for similar properties has risen by 57.4% since January 2020.
